Endesa develops more French wind

10 July 2007


The project, Endesa’s fourth in France, will be located in Muzillac on the Gulf of Morbihan in Brittany.

The Muzillac facility will be equipped with six ECO 80 turbines each with a capacity of 1.67 MW.

The excavation and civil engineering work is expected to commence in the first quarter of 2008, with the farm staled to come on stream in October.
